by Brian H. on Saturday night review - MUSIC: If you like house music, you must check this place out. The main floor was playing house music all night and the sound system isn't the greatest but it is LOUD. From 11-12ish, the first DJ was playing all the house hits you'd expect and then the later DJ started playing more dirty house/dubstep stuff which was interesting to experience at a club. The music selection probably depends on the DJ but we ran into one of the owners later and he said they pretty much play the same type of music every Saturday. There's a downstairs area playing top 40 but it's pretty dark, murky, gross, and why waste time there when you got awesome music upstairs. Oh and you have the super bright light machine thing up front that blinds you when the smoke comes out. LINE: Guest list ends at 11pm and we got there around 10:40 so the line was super long. We didn't want to wait so we paid the bouncer to let our group in which was still cheaper than paying $20 cover. DRINKS: Drinks were $10-15 for the usual cocktails and shots. The bartender we had poured way more than a shot into my vodka redbull and it tasted more like vodka on the rocks than anything, which in terms of taste was terrible but it the alcohol content made it worth it. I'd suggest getting the Coronas for $5 though. CROWD: From the looks of the crowd, it seemed like most people were new to house music on the main floor in a club. There was a pretty good mix of asians, whites, black, and quite a few indians. I was concerned there might be a lot of ghetto people since someone was killed here a few weeks previous, but it wasn't that much worse than any other club. 5 stars for GREAT music, cheap drink options, a cheap guest list if you can make it in time..and umm playing Afrojack multiple times :)
